Call for thermostat service if:

  • The display is blank or unresponsive with fresh batteries
  • Room temperature doesn't match the thermostat reading
  • Heating or cooling runs past the set point or never reaches it
  • The system short-cycles after a thermostat swap (wiring or staging fault)
  • Your heat pump's aux heat runs when it shouldn't
  • You want scheduling, remote control, or energy reports you don't have

Thermostat Repair & Installation in Bethlehem — FAQs

Do I need a C-wire for a smart thermostat?

Most smart thermostats want one for reliable power. Many Bethlehem-area homes built before the 2000s only ran four wires. Solutions include pulling a new wire, using the spare conductor if one exists, or installing the manufacturer's power adapter — a tech can tell which applies in minutes.

Can I install a smart thermostat on a heat pump myself?

It's the riskiest DIY thermostat scenario. Heat pumps use extra conductors for the reversing valve and auxiliary heat, and mis-mapping them can run aux strips constantly (huge bills) or feed heat when you asked for cooling. Professional configuration takes under an hour and includes full sequence testing.

Where should a thermostat be located?

On an interior wall, away from direct sun, supply vents, kitchens, and exterior doors — about five feet up. A thermostat in a bad spot reads wrong all day, and relocating it (or using a smart thermostat's remote sensors) often fixes 'my house never feels right' complaints without touching the equipment.

My new thermostat causes the furnace to turn on and off rapidly — why?

Usually a wiring or configuration mismatch: the cycle rate set wrong for the equipment type, a missing C-wire causing power-stealing resets, or heat staging misconfigured. Short-cycling wears equipment fast, so it's worth correcting immediately rather than living with it.
